ITEM 5. CONDITIONAL USE APPLICATION CU16-26 TEXAS GUN EXPERIENCE
First for the Commission to consider and make recommendation to City Council was
conditional use permit application CU16-26 for property located at 1901 South Main
Street and platted as Lot 1, Block 3, Metroplace 2,d Installment. The applicant was
requesting a conditional use permit to amend the previously approved site plan of
CU00-26 (Ord. 00-62) for a planned commercial center, specifically to allow for a two
story 34,900 square foot indoor shooting range and office space.
In the Commission's regular session Theresa Mason moved to approve conditional use
application CU16-26. Jimmy Fechter seconded the motion, which prevailed by the
following vote:
Ayes: Oliver, Wilson, Hotelling, Fechter, Tiggelaar, Luers and Mason
Nays: None
ITEM 6. HISTORIC LANDMARK SUBDISTRICT HL16-08 HARRINGTON HOUSE
Next for the Commission to consider and make recommendation to City Council was
historic landmark subdistrict HL16-08 for property located at 713 East Texas Street and
platted as Lot 11, Block 105, College Heights, The applicant was requesting an historic
landmark subdistrict designation to be known as the Harrington House.
In the Commission's regular session Monica Hotelling moved to approve historic
landmark subdistrict HI -16-08. B J Wilson seconded the motion, which prevailed by the
following vote:
Ayes: Oliver, Wilson, Hotelling, Fechter, Tiggelaar, Luers and Mason
Nays: None
